A fine balance of the savagely funny and heartbreaking.\" --\u003c\/i\u003eBookseller \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e Emer Martin is an original, radical and vital voice in Irish writing who challenges the history of silence, institutional lies, evasion and the mistreatment of women across mid twentieth-century Ireland.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e Two families intertwine in this energetic new work, an epic intergenerational saga that began with \u003ci\u003eThe Cruelty Men\u003c\/i\u003e (2018) and continues here as punk rockers and Catholic laundries collide and spiral forward into a post-colonial Ireland still haunted by history. Interweaving scenes from Ireland's mythological past, the Tudor plantations, the Magdalene laundries and the 1980s, The Thirsty Ghosts is epic in scope but intimate in focus.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e The Lyons, professionals in a newly independent state, are attacked by paramilitaries in their family home in Tyrone. The displaced eccentric O'Conaills, traumatized by industrial schools and laundries, find themselves in leafy Dublin 4. There's a servant girl who meets Henry VIII, a Lithuanian Jewish family who become part of the fabric of Dublin, and a wild young girl who escapes the laundry only to stumble into a psycho pimp.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e Related with dark humor and high literary style, \u003ci\u003eThe Thirsty Ghosts\u003c\/i\u003e is a revelatory exploration of Ireland; its themes of power, class, fertility, violence and deep love are as universal as the old stories that illuminate the characters' lives. \u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003eBinding Type:\u003c\/b\u003e Paperback\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003ePublisher:\u003c\/b\u003e Lilliput Press\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003ePublished:\u003c\/b\u003e 05\/28\/2024\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003eISBN:\u003c\/b\u003e 9781843518631\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003ePages:\u003c\/b\u003e 352","brand":"Emer Martin","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":43838700945589,"sku":"9781843518631","price":21.24,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0473\/0804\/6492\/files\/img_2e375189-a030-4336-bb08-aaae259d9b72.jpg?v=1712028473","url":"https:\/\/pastforward.org\/products\/thirsty-ghosts-9781843518631","provider":"Past Forward","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
